FROM THE GLOBALLY BESTSELLING AUTHOR OF GIRL WITH A PEARL EARRING

Violet is 38.

The First World War took everything from her. Her brother, her fiancé – and her future. She is now considered a ‘surplus woman’.

But Violet is also fiercely independent and determined. Escaping her suffocating mother, she moves to Winchester to start a new life –a change that will require courage, resilience and acts of quiet rebellion. And when whispers of another world war surface, she must live with a secret that could change everything…

I thoroughly enjoyed this. It was beautifully and emphatically written and the narrator - Fenella Woolgar - really bought the characters, particularly Violet, to life. A slow-paced, character driven novel, with themes of family, friendship, identity, place and a particular time in history, A Single Thread was well researched and beautifully woven together. This was my first book by Tracy Chevalier, but it will certainly not be my last.
